摘要
[C-11]Carfentanil ([C-11]CFN) is a selective radiotracer for in vivo positron emission tomography imaging studies of the -opioid system that, in our laboratories, is synthesized by methylation of the corresponding carboxylate precursor with [C-11]MeOTf, and purified using a C2 solid-phase extraction cartridge. Changes in the commercial availability of common C2 cartridges have necessitated future proofing the synthesis of [C-11]CFN to maintain reliable delivery of the radiotracer for clinical imaging studies. An updated synthesis of [C-11]CFN is reported that replaces a now obsolete purification cartridge with a new commercially available version and also substitutes the organic solvents used in traditional production methods with ethanol.
